Printable preschool lesson plans can be used in a variety of ways. You can use them to create a daily or weekly schedule, or as a guide for specific activities and lessons. They can also be used to track progress and identify areas where your child may need extra support. Some popular themes for printable preschool lesson plans include alphabet and number recognition, shapes and colors, and social skills like sharing and taking turns. By using these plans, you can help your child develop important skills and build a strong foundation for future learning.
